You just ate a big meal with a lot of carbs. You have a lot of glucose molecules floating around in your bloodstream. The pancreas releases the protein insulin, which helps your cells recognize that they need to take in glucose. There are 10 glucose molecules outside of the cell and 2 glucose molecules inside the cell. How will the glucose molecule be transported into the cell?
